.NET中查看一个强命名程序集(*****.dll)的PublicKeyToken的方法:

使用命令行工具SDK Command Prompt,键入:SN -T C:\*****.dll

就会显示出该dll具体的PublicKeyToken数值。

如果该程序集没有强命名,则不会有PublicKeyToken数值。

将一个程序集强命名的方法是:

用SN -k C:\***.snk命令生成***.snk文件,将该snk文件加载到项目中。在项目上右键属性,选择Signing选项卡,钩选中“Sign the assembly”,再在下拉列表中选择刚才生成的***.snk,重新编译程序集。

此后,该程序集就被强命名了,它的PublicKeyToken就有相应数值了。

关于PublicKeyToken相关推荐

  1. .net C# 关于使用npoi导入excel 所遇到的问题PublicKeyToken=0df73ec7942b34e1

    最近在做一些小项目,需要使用导入导出excel表格从数据库,最常用的还是npoi这个开源类库吧 以下是基本代码 //创建一个excel表,就是创建workbookHSSFWorkbook wk=new ...

  2. 未能加载文件或程序集“Oracle.DataAccess, Version=2.112.1.0, Culture=neutral, PublicKeyToken=89b483f429c47342...

    若本机的Oracle版本是64位系统,则在调用Oracle数据的时间报以下错误: [未能加载文件或程序集"Oracle.DataAccess, Version=2.112.1.0, Cult ...

  3. 未能加载文件或程序集“System.Data.SQLite, Version=1.0.96.0, Culture=neutral, PublicKeyToken=db937bc2d44ff139...

    不少朋友在使用C#连接SQLite后会出现错误:其他信息: 未能加载文件或程序集"System.Data.SQLite, Version=1.0.96.0, Culture=neutral, ...

  4. Enterprise Library启用签名后发生 PublicKeyToken错误,HRESULT:0x80131040解决

    错误信息如下: 创建 dataConfiguration 的配置节处理程序时出错: 未能加载文件或程序集"Microsoft.Practices.EnterpriseLibrary.Data ...

  5. 如何查看PublicKeyToken

    对于已经签名的 Assembly, 使用如下命令查看 PublicKeyToken sn -T <assemblyname.dll> C:\Program Files\Microsoft ...

  6. IIS:System.Data, Version=2.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089”类型的权限已失败。

    System.Security.SecurityException: 请求"System.Data.SqlClient.SqlClientPermission, System.Data, V ...

  7. System.Core, Version=2.0.5.0, Culture=neutral, PublicKeyToken=7cec85d7bea7798e, Retargetable=Yes”

    "System.Core, Version=2.0.5.0, Culture=neutral, PublicKeyToken=7cec85d7bea7798e, Retargetable=Y ...

  8. 查看程序集(*.dll)的PublicKeyToken

    使用vs的Tools Command Prompt命令行工具,输入SN -T "path",就会显示这个dll 的PublicKeyToken. 比如:C:\Program Fil ...

  9. .net 查看程序集(*.dll)的PublicKeyToken

    1.运行=>powershell ([system.reflection.assembly]::loadfile("C:\Users\wangbinbin\Desktop\bin\lo ...

最新文章

  1. SpringBoot+Vue实现指定账号审批单据时前端进行语音播报
  2. net中一些所封装的类
  3. ZigBee技术的应用和优势
  4. mysql一个事务多个log_MySQL识别一个binlog中的一个事物
  5. 【SpringMVC】SpringMVC系列6之@CookieValue 映射请求Cookie 值
  6. Microsoft Visual Studio 2008从试用版转为正式版
  7. go mod导入本地包
  8. Spring项目在启动时报Error running 'ProviderC': Cannot start process, the working directory 'E:\ ' does not
  9. 英特尔再爆重大芯片漏洞,苹果谷歌微软相继中招!
  10. 编辑器sublime text3和插件package control、Sidebar Enhancements插件安装
  11. 电脑中了MEMZ病毒怎么办
  12. 面向对象基础实战——飞机大战
  13. pyqt5——工具栏
  14. 悼念512汶川大地震遇难同胞——珍惜现在,感恩生活(多重背包)
  15. 读取、回收和重用:使用 Excel、XML 和 Java 技术轻松搞定报告,第 2 部分
  16. 比较两个字符串s1和s2的大小,如果s1s2,则输出一个正数;若s1=s2,则输出0;若s1小于s2,则输出一个负数。要求:不用strcpy函数;两个字符串用gets函数读入。
  17. 生成拼音语料及拼音识别转换成中文
  18. java元数据的概念_元数据 概念及分类
  19. linux下的磁盘状态查看方式
  20. 2020年前端面试题(二)之VUE篇

热门文章

  1. input file 上传图片及压缩
  2. element中关于el-autocomplete和validate规则trigger/change之间的问题
  3. Apache运行正常,但是localhost却打不开页面
  4. lamda函数的简介
  5. c语言系统时间的结构体变量,C语言中的系统时间结构体类型
  6. 联想小新触控板不行了
  7. redis中的incr和incrBy
  8. 模型优化之模型融合|集成学习
  9. 【龙芯1B】:有源蜂鸣器例程
  10. Linux 复制、粘贴快捷键